What Is Canyam?
Canyam is an academic research and literature discovery platform powered by AI. Instead of requiring researchers to rely on separate tools for finding papers, requesting literature, reviewing studies, and discovering related research, Canyam brings several of these functions into one environment.
The platform focuses on four major areas:
- Academic paper requests
- Personalized research paper recommendations
- AI-powered paper summaries
- Academic literature search
These features are intended to help researchers move more efficiently from discovering a paper to understanding whether it is relevant to their work.

3. AI-Powered Research Paper Summaries
Finding a paper is only the beginning. Researchers still need to determine whether the study is relevant enough to read in full.
Canyam provides AI-powered paper summaries that can extract important information from academic research. Canyam article pages can present information such as an overview, abstract-related information, background, key highlights, visual analysis, and future outlook.
This makes summaries particularly useful during the early stages of literature review.
A researcher can first examine the important points of a study and then decide whether the original paper deserves a complete reading.
AI summaries should not replace careful reading of the original research, particularly when methodology, statistical analysis, limitations, or precise conclusions are important. Instead, they can act as a faster first layer of research screening.
4. Academic Literature Search
At the center of Canyam is its literature search functionality.
The platform describes its search system as supporting academic literature discovery with semantic understanding and multiple search dimensions.
This matters because academic concepts are not always described using exactly the same terminology.
For example, researchers studying a particular scientific problem may encounter related papers that use alternative terminology, abbreviations, technical phrases, or neighboring concepts.
A research platform that understands more than literal keyword matching can make it easier to explore the academic literature surrounding a topic.

Can AI Replace Reading Research Papers?
No. AI research tools are most useful when they help researchers decide what deserves closer attention.
Important academic decisions should still rely on original research papers.
When evaluating a study, researchers should carefully inspect factors such as:
- Research methodology
- Sample size
- Data collection
- Statistical methods
- Study limitations
- Author conclusions
- References
- Publication context
Canyam's AI tools can support this process by helping users understand the research landscape before moving into detailed analysis.
